I have an old vice where the thread box was made by swaging it over the 
screw.  I discovered this when it started to slip.  I fixed it using the 
same method, I got the box hot, quickly inserted the screw and hammered it 
into the swage block.

I have seen threads made for a screw by drilling and inserting a row of
brass/bronze bolts/rods so that the flat ends fit into the threads of the
screw.
